Private Investigator: Cost of hiring?

  • Common salary in Moncton, NB: $46,093 yearly
  • Typical salaries range from $34,165$62,186 yearly

*Indeed data (CA)

What's the average time to fill a private investigator role?

The average time to fill a private investigator role is 103 days, calculated from the moment the job is posted until a candidate accepts the offer.
